The medical term for high blood cholesterol and triglycerides is lipid disorder. Such a disorder occurs when you have too many fatty substances in your blood.
|
|
Hypercholesterolemia refers to levels of cholesterol in the blood that are higher than normal.Cholesterol circulates in the blood stream. It is an essential molecule for the human body.
